I definately see where you are going with the vendor thing, but the fact is they want to lure people away from major cities. And vendors aren't meant to be vanity items - these droids are. Vendors are meant to be the backbone of the economy.
I understand the aversion to spamming, but I think you are looking at the symptom as the problem, and not the problem itself.
The problem is that there is little advertising available, and in a game where the economy is entirely player based that is a severe limitation. We have all these pretty shops but no one knows about them. Vendor listings on the planetary map aren't enough.
The point is to get the people to the vendors, not bring the vendors to the people.
I assume there will be a way to ignore these droids if you so choose (if not, it will be soon, I'm sure because of the nerf cries already beginning), but I don't see the harm in having them, only the benefit.
You aren't going to "stop" spamming. Long term, there needs to be true global advertising in game, but like it or not spatial messages at Starports are the way business is going to be done for the forseeable future. There is no way with storage exploits and other issues that they are ever going to implement vendor mechanisms on droids that aren't severely limited - and if you can only get, say, 10 items on a droid at once, you might as well just stand there and sell them by hand.
I understand your frustration on the issue - I have days where I type /addignore when I can't stand it either - but for right now it is the best way to get people aware of something being available. I'd love for them to bring back vendor listings on the bazaar, but it doesn't seem like that is going to happen.
Since it's a merchant skill, it's really not going to change the spamming habits of "100K ore gotta sell now PST" people, but it will simply be an elegant way for a merchant to advertise their wares.
Spamming is ugly, but until people get a real, viable alternative it is going to be a fact of life, as it is in any MMO.
